Satirizar means to use satire to criticize or mock someone or something, often in a humorous or exaggerated way. It is commonly used in contexts of literature, art, or speech to highlight flaws or absurdities.
El Pretérito Perfecto - used to describe actions that started recently and are still happening now

Pronoun | Conjugation |
---|---|
Yo | he satirizado |
Tú | has satirizado |
Él / Ella / Usted | ha satirizado |
Nosotros / Nosotras | hemos satirizado |
Vosotros / Vosotras | habéis satirizado |
Ellos / Ellas / Ustedes | han satirizado |
